Output d290e481a1df161c2a5a45338ed4a0243014b0d0236ab50f26c9dc55f2ea17ea:0

value
175193963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79a9c1d15912076b28f322d96ced21ec1edb075 OP_EQUAL
address
3QGE3QQfzDA7BMKfQe6zg1gpgbyDkhhhZG
transaction
d290e481a1df161c2a5a45338ed4a0243014b0d0236ab50f26c9dc55f2ea17ea
confirmations
282976
spent
true